The Boermarke in Crooswijk has been brightened up considerably thanks to a new mural by the Colombian artist Juan Barco. "I like to make great works of art."

The new mural was created thanks to a collaboration between Havensteder and the neighbourhood. District manager Ron Klove of the housing corporation got the ball rolling.
He explains: 'As neighborhood managers, we indicate every year what is needed to keep our neighborhood livable, whole, clean and safe. We also have a budget for that. To me, a work of art on the bare facade on the Boermarke seemed like an asset to the neighborhood.'
And Ron also knew exactly which artist he wanted to use for this: Juan Barco. The Colombian made a striking work of art in the Agniesebuurt last year.
Ron also knocked on the door of active neighborhood resident Els van Vliet. She was immediately enthusiastic about the idea and involved her neighbors. Ron says: ' Els showed the residents what was possible. And asked them what they would like.”
There was a peasant theme. As a kind of ode to the street names in this neighborhood. Artist Juan set to work energetically. In a few weeks he painted huge cow heads and a farmer on the facade of the Boermarke.
“Everyone who saw me work was very happy,” says Juan. 'I only got positive reactions.' And he himself also enjoyed working on this. "I like to make great works of art."
